Ingredients
To create these delightful cookies, gather the following ingredients:
- 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up powdered s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1 tablespoon key lime juice
- 1 teaspoon lime zest
- 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up powdered sugar (for glaze)
- 2 tablespoons key lime juice (for glaze)
- 1 teaspoon lime zest (for glaze)

Step-by-Step Instructions
-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ures even baking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. Set aside.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and powdered sugar until the mixture is light and fluffy, approximately 2-3 minutes.
- Add Egg and Flavorings: Beat in the egg, key lime juice, lime zest, and vanilla extract until well combined.
- Combine Mixtures: Gradually add the dry ingredient mixture to the wet ingredients, mixing until just incorporated. Do not overmix!
- Scoop Cookies: Using a cookie scoop or tablespoon, place rounded balls of dough on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, spacing them about 2 inches apart.
- Bake: Bake for 10-12 minutes. The edges should be lightly golden, while the centers will still look soft.
- Make the Glaze: While the cookies are cooling, whisk together the powdered sugar, key lime juice, and lime zest in a small bowl until smooth.
- Glaze the Cookies: Once the cookies have cooled, drizzle the lime glaze on top for an irresistible finish.

Top Tips for Perfecting Key Lime Cookies with Lime Glaze
- Substitutions: You can use coconut oil or a vegan butter substitute if you’d like to go dairy-free without compromising taste!
- Timing: Be sure to watch the cookies closely while baking – a minute too long can lead to more crunch than chew!
- Common Mistakes: Avoid overmixing your cookie dough, as this can lead to tough cookies. Mix just until combined.
Storing and Reheating Tips
To keep your Key Lime Cookies with Lime Glaze in prime condition,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. If you want to freeze them, allow the cookies to cool completely before placing them in a freezer-safe bag. They can be frozen for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y them, simply thaw at room temperature or reheat them in the microwave for 10-15 seconds for that fresh-baked taste.
